How Maria’s approaches work online

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) focuses on helping people notice unhelpful thoughts and choose actions that match their values. It is useful for anxiety, depression and coping with big life changes. Client-Centred Therapy puts the person’s experience at the heart of sessions, offering non-judgemental listening and support to build confidence and self-understanding. Psychodynamic Therapy looks at patterns from past relationships and experiences to make sense of repeated difficulties and emotional reactions. Finding the right approach is part of the work. Maria will discuss these methods with each person and try a path that fits their goals and preferences. This is a collaborative process where techniques are adapted as needs change. Online therapy offers practical flexibility. Video calls allow a full face-to-face conversation when that helps. Phone sessions can be easier if bandwidth is limited or for quick check-ins. Live chat or text-based messaging suits brief updates, reflection between sessions, or when someone prefers not to use a camera. These options make it easier to fit therapy around work, childcare or travel and to keep momentum between appointments.
